Operator SQL IN

Operator SQL IN

Operator SQL IN memungkinkan kamu untuk menentukan berapa suatu nilai record data dalam klausa WHERE.

Operator SQL IN adalah arti untuk beberapa nilai tertentu didalam berikut .

SQL IN Sintaks :
SELECT nama_kolom
FROM nama_table
WHERE nama_kolom IN (nilai1, nilai2, ...);
atau:
SELECT nama_kolom
FROM nama_table
WHERE nama_kolom IN (SELECT STATEMNET);

Operator SQL IN Contoh 
Pernyataan SQL berikut menampilkan semua customer yang berlokasi di "Germany", "France" dan "UK":
SELECT * FROM Customers
WHERE Country IN ('Germany', 'France', 'UK');
hasilnya hanya akan menampilkan semua customer yang memiliki country Germany UK dan France

Pernyataan SQL berikut memilih semua customer yang TIDAK berlokasi di "Germany", "France" atau "UK":
SELECT * FROM Customers
WHERE Country NOT IN ('Germany', 'France', 'UK');
hasilnya tidak akan menampilkan customer yang memiliki country Germany France dan UK

Pernyataan SQL berikut memilih semua customer yang berasal dari negara yang sama dengan supplier:
SELECT * FROM Customers
WHERE Country IN (SELECT Country FROM Suppliers);
untuk hasil yang ini akan menampilkan semua customer sesuai dengan supplier berdasarkan country yang sama,jika kalian ingin melihat country dari supplier silakan SELECT Country FROM Suppliers


Berlangganan update artikel terbaru via email:

0 Response to "Operator SQL IN"

Iklan Atas Artikel

Iklan Tengah Artikel 1

Iklan Tengah Artikel 2

Iklan Bawah Artikel